Who are we? Inhouse Consulting (IC) is an internal management consulting group function working exclusively for all functions and sectors. IC projects span topics like strategy & execution, processes & efficiency, integration, innovation & business development, R&D, organizational development, and PMO across the company. Our team consists of 80 colleagues that work globally. The IC Head Office is at the HQ in Darmstadt, Germany, with the Americas office in the Boston area, USA, and the Asia-Pacific (APAC) office in Singapore. This position offers a smooth transition from an external consultancy environment to an industry. IC work leverages your consultancy skillset and maintains the merits of consultancy like the variety of strategic projects, international travel, and high-level visibility. In addition, IC offers complete autonomy and freedom to drive your projects and develop your career.
